Just to clarify/reiterate one more time - There are NO "Schedules" at K4.

Your "schedule" is as follows, regardless of Seniority:

1st --------------------------------------16th

OR

16th --------------------------------------30th


(With the logical exception for a 31 day month)

It doesn't matter who you are, or, what you bid.

The real question is, do you want your 2 week vacation at the beginning of the Month or at the end of the Month?
